A specialized station within an automated forging and stamping line that performs high-accuracy pressing operations on metal workpieces.

| pressure: | Max 5000 kN (1124 kip) pressing force, 300 bar (4350 psi) hydraulic system pressure |
| other spec: | Cycle time: 2-30 seconds, Positioning accuracy: ±0.01 mm (±0.0004 in), Flow rate: 50-200 L/min (13-53 gal/min) hydraulic oil |
| temperature: | Ambient to 200°C (392°F) for standard seals, up to 400°C (752°F) with high-temp options |

The station features a high-strength steel frame for durability and tool steel for precision dies and punches, ensuring long-lasting performance in demanding manufacturing environments.
The integrated control system precisely regulates hydraulic ram pressure and mechanical slide positioning, enabling consistent high-accuracy operations with minimal workpiece variation.
Yes, the Precision Pressing Station is designed for seamless integration with automated forging and stamping lines, featuring standardized interfaces for workpiece clamping and material handling systems.
